This may be a noob question. If so, a pointer to the appropriate documentation will be appreciated.

In 2D and 3D CAD programs, the user can create construction lines and construction brushes. These never show up in the finished product, and are never exported, but they're very useful as drawing and sizing guides. If I were modeling my house, for example, I would create a box the same size and shape as my house as my first step, and then build the rest of the house using the box as a guide.

Does CShop have anything similar, besides just the grid? I think QuArK does, but I'm not sure.
